Two NWO ECCM KICkstart DE-NL projects awarded to Aayan Banerjee to explore promising pathways to advance ceramic-membrane based electrolysers.
In collaboration with EIFER and Shell, the first project "CO2 methanation using high temperature proton-conducting ceramic electrolysers" will look to demonstrate proof-of-concept for CO2 methanation directly inside a proton-ceramic steam electrolysis cell.
In collaboration with TNO, KIT, Sunfire and Shell, the second project "Solid Oxide Electrolyser modelling: Exploring scale-up of cell size" will investigate the maximum threshold for planar cell area of solid oxide cells based on mechanical stability (specifically crack initiation and propagation) under operation.
